Background
In a recent development in the cricketing world, former Australian cricketer Jason Gillespie has openly criticized Pakistan’s coach, Aaqib Javed. The comments have sparked discussions among cricket enthusiasts and experts, highlighting tensions within the cricket community.
Key Points of Criticism
- Coaching Methods: Gillespie has raised concerns about Javed’s coaching techniques, suggesting they may not be effective in nurturing young talent.
- Team Performance: The criticism comes in the wake of Pakistan’s inconsistent performances, which Gillespie attributes partly to Javed’s strategies.
- Player Development: Gillespie believes that Javed’s approach may hinder the development of players, potentially affecting their international careers.
Reactions and Implications
The comments have elicited mixed reactions from the cricketing community. Some support Gillespie’s views, while others defend Javed’s track record and contributions to Pakistan cricket.
- Support for Gillespie: A section of cricket analysts agrees with Gillespie, emphasizing the need for a fresh perspective in Pakistan’s coaching staff.
- Defense of Javed: Supporters of Javed argue that his experience and past successes should not be overlooked.
